直播切片项目拆解:七步流程!

直播切片项目拆解流程

随着互联网的快速发展,直播行业也迎来了蓬勃的发展机遇。而在直播过程中,为了提供更好的用户体验和减少带宽压力,切片技术成为了必不可少的一环。那么直播切片项目拆解流程,如何进行直播切片项目的拆解流程呢?小编将从七个方面为大家详细介绍。

一、需求分析与规划

在开始直播切片项目之前,我们首先需要明确项目的需求和目标。这包括确定要支持的直播平台、用户量预估、切片质量要求等等。通过详细的需求分析和规划,可以为后续的工作提供清晰的方向。

二、系统设计与架构

在进行直播切片项目的设计时,需要考虑到系统的整体架构和各个模块之间的关系。这包括选择合适的流媒体服务器、编码方案、传输协议等。同时,还需要考虑到系统的可扩展性和稳定性,以应对未来可能出现的用户增长和流量变化。

三、编码与封装

在直播过程中,视频流需要经过编码和封装才能被传输和播放。这一步骤需要选择合适的编码器和封装格式,并进行相应的配置。同时,还需要注意视频编码参数的选择,以平衡视频质量和带宽占用。

四、切片与存储

切片是直播过程中的核心环节,通过将直播流分割成小段视频文件,可以提供更好的用户体验和灵活性。在切片过程中直播切片项目拆解流程,需要确定切片时长和数量,并选择合适的切片策略。同时,还需要考虑到切片文件的存储方式和管理机制。

五、传输与分发

完成切片后,接下来就是将切片文件传输给用户进行播放。这一步骤需要选择合适的传输协议和CDN服务商,并进行相应的配置。同时,还需要考虑到用户地域分布和网络状况,以提供更快速、稳定的传输体验。

六、播放与缓存

在用户端进行直播观看时,需要进行播放器的选择和配置。同时,为了提供更好的观看体验,还可以引入缓存机制。通过缓存已经播放过的切片文件,在用户再次观看时可以减少加载时间,并提供无缝切换效果。

七、监测与优化

完成直播切片项目后,需要进行系统的监测和优化工作。通过监测系统的性能指标和用户反馈,可以及时发现问题并进行优化。同时,还可以借助数据分析工具,深入了解用户观看行为和需求,以进一步提升直播体验。

总结起来,直播切片项目的拆解流程包括需求分析与规划、系统设计与架构、编码与封装、切片与存储、传输与分发、播放与缓存以及监测与优化。只有在每个环节都做到严谨细致,才能够保证直播切片项目的顺利实施和用户体验的提升。

小编温馨提示:fyxm-专注于分享与收集全网优质资源,网址:www..

© 版权声明
THE END
喜欢就支持一下吧
点赞2981 分享